We are seeking a hard-working Procurement Manager. Procurement Management oversees the end-to-end procurement lifecycle, from strategic sourcing through contract execution, ensuring operational excellence and alignment with category strategies. This role leads supplier selection, relationship management, and contract compliance while driving adherence to procurement policies and procedures. The position is also responsible for executing supplier diversity and sustainability initiatives, supporting organizational goals through effective supplier engagement and risk-managed procurement practices.
This position is located at our Germantown, MD location, join us in our mission to serve patients with our next generation of innovative Gene Therapies.
This position will perform a broad range of tasks.
D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ES:
- Responsible for the end-to-end procurement management of different categories, including but not limited to material, services, equipment, and engineering across both our commercial and our R&D functions.
- Negotiate and manage purchasing contracts to improve key terms including price, payment terms, lead time, quality standards and after-sales service, ensure quality and mitigate risks.
- Develop and execute strategic sourcing strategies for API raw materials, intermediates, excipients, solvents, packaging, and contract services.
- Ensures uninterrupted supply of compliant raw materials and services while optimizing cost, quality, risk, and supplier performance.
- Identify and mitigate supply risks related to single‑source dependencies, geopolitical issues, and regulatory changes.
- Develop contingency and business continuity plans for critical materials.
- Manage purchase requests and procurement activities for a range of goods and services, applying professional judgment to ensure compliance with company Sarbanes-Oxley policies and business objectives.
- Evaluate requisitions for completeness, appropriateness, and risk, and determine the most effective procurement approach based on spend level, complexity, and business impact.
- Oversee timely and accurate receiving processes for both physical goods and services, ensuring that receipts and confirmations of service completion are properly recorded in the ERP system to support three‑way match controls and enable accurate and timely invoice processing and payment
